Jashwanth's blog
http://www.parrot.org/blog/1383
Parrot is a virtual machine designed to efficiently compile and execute bytecode for dynamic languages. Parrot currently hosts a variety of language implementations in various stages of completion, including Tcl, Javascript, Ruby, Lua, Scheme, PHP, Python, Perl 6, APL, and a .NET bytecode translator. Parrot is not about parrots, though we are rather fond of them for obvious reasons.enProgress till now
http://www.parrot.org/content/progress-till-now
<p>Till now was able to add the function to compute the eigenvalues. Also fixed the segmentation fault in the inverse function to do this has to edit the LU decomposition function to get results of couple of arrays. Now will be starting to work on the implementation of the function for eigenvectors and also try to develop the tests for inverse and eigenvalues functions.</p>
http://www.parrot.org/content/progress-till-now#commentsMon, 02 Jul 2012 17:05:53 +0000Jashwanth418 at http://www.parrot.orgTesting Part
http://www.parrot.org/content/testing-part
<p>This week was spent on fixing the errors encountered basically by adding get_pointers() functions to some of the files in parrot and pla.Then later on started to write tests on the project to check the correctness of the result from lapack subroutines but have to change the implementation of the initial file so that it would be helpful for the testing part.Had also encountered and learned about an error from git regarding merge conflict. </p>
http://www.parrot.org/content/testing-part#commentsMon, 18 Jun 2012 16:25:03 +0000Jashwanth412 at http://www.parrot.orgThe initial step
http://www.parrot.org/content/initial-step
<p>This is about the project "LAPACK binding with PLA".<br />
To implement the project have been using winxed,read some code and examples related to this on <a href="http://whiteknight.github.com/Rosella/winxed/index.html" title="http://whiteknight.github.com/Rosella/winxed/index.html">http://whiteknight.github.com/Rosella/winxed/index.html</a><br />
and have started to code in the same.<br />
Till date have am trying to call the LAPACK function by using some of the matrices in PLA but got an error regarding a pointer and trying to figure out the cause as everything being passed to the lapack function is a pointer.</p>
http://www.parrot.org/content/initial-step#commentsMon, 11 Jun 2012 17:35:31 +0000Jashwanth408 at http://www.parrot.orgLAPACK bindings for Parrot-Linear-Algebra
http://www.parrot.org/content/lapack-bindings-parrot-linear-algebra
<p>LAPACK bindings for Parrot-Linear-Algebra so as to provide an interface for the basic linear algebra functions.In modern treatments of linear algebra, matrices are considered first. Matrices provide a theoretically and practically useful way of approaching many types of problems including: solution of systems of linear equations,graph theory, theory of games, computer graphics,data compression,etc.</p>
http://www.parrot.org/content/lapack-bindings-parrot-linear-algebra#commentsWed, 25 Apr 2012 15:50:02 +0000Jashwanth399 at http://www.parrot.org